MOC 55172 - Managing Development Projects with Team Foundation Server 2015

See Course Outline

Training for your Team

2
Days
  • Private Class for your Team
  • Online or On-location
  • Customizable
  • Expert Instructors
Overview

This two-day instructor-led is intended for application developer and application development manager who are interested in using Visual Studio Team Foundation Server 2015 for managing development projects. In this course, students learn how to configure Visual Studio Team Foundation Server 2015. Students then learn how to manage application development life-cycle with Visual Studio Team Foundation Server (TFS) 2015.

This course is intended for both programmers who have experience in developing applications with Visual Studio.

Goals
  1. Learn to configure and Manage Visual Studio Team Foundation Server 2015.
  2. Learn to manage a development project with Visual Studio Team Foundation Server 2015.
Outline
  1. Overview of TFS 2015
    1. Overview of TFS
    2. What's New in TFS 2015
    3. Connect to TFS 2015
    4. Configuring TFS 2015
    5. Lab: Overview of TFS 2015
      1. Create a Project Collection
      2. Connect Team Explorer to TFS
  2. Application Life Cycle Management with TFS
    1. Overview of TFS Process
    2. Overview of Agile Tools
    3. Using Project Portal for Issue Tracking
    4. Lab: Application Life Cycle Management with TFS
      1. Creating Work Item
      2. Linking Work Item
  3. Managing Project with Agile Development Method
    1. Overview of Agile Development Methodologies
    2. Managing Agile Projects with TFS
    3. Lab: Managing Project with Agile Development Method
      1. Creating Agile Project
      2. Create User Feature
  4. Managing Project with SCRUM Development Method
    1. Overview of SCRUM Development Methodologies
    2. Managing SCRUM Projects with TFS
    3. Lab: Managing Project with SCRUM Development Method
      1. Creating SCRUM Project
      2. Create Product Backlog Item
  5. Managing Project with CMMI Development Method
    1. Overview of CMMI Development Methodologies
    2. Managing CMMI Projects with TFS
    3. Lab: Managing Project with CMMI Development Method
      1. Creating CMMI Project
      2. Create Test Cases
  6. Managing Source Code with TFS
    1. Version Control System
    2. Using Team Foundation Version Control
    3. Using Git
    4. Managing Version Control
    5. Lab: Managing Source Code with TFVC
      1. Create TFVC Repository
      2. Configure Check-in Quality Check
    6. Lab: Managing Source Code with TFS Git
      1. Create Git Repository
      2. Using Git in Visual Studio
    7. Lab: Controlling Access to Source Control
      1. Restrict Access to Source
  7. Using Continuous Integration Build
    1. Requirements for Using Continuous Integration Build
    2. Configuring Continuous Integration Build
    3. Lab: Using Continuous Integration
      1. Install Build Agent
      2. Configure Build Definition
      3. Using Gated Check-in
      4. Using Unit Test with Continuous Build
  8. Using Release Management
    1. Overview of Release Management
    2. Requirements for using Release Management
    3. Configuring Release Management
    4. Lab: Using Release Management
      1. Configure Release Definition
      2. Test Release Management
  9. Reporting
    1. Overview of Reporting
    2. Configuring TFS Reporting
    3. Configuring Excel Reporting
    4. Lab: Reporting
      1. Configure TFS Reporting
      2. Accessing Excel Reports
Class Materials

Each student in our Live Online and our Onsite classes receives a comprehensive set of materials, including course notes and all the class examples.

Class Prerequisites

Experience in the following is required for this Team Foundation Server class:

  • Experience with developing using Visual Studio.
  • Basic understanding of application development life-cycle.
  • Basic understanding of application development methodologies.
Preparing for Class

No cancelation for low enrollment

Certified Microsoft Partner

Registered Education Provider (R.E.P.)

GSA schedule pricing

93,987

Students who have taken Live Online Training

16,159

Organizations who trust Webucator for their training needs

100%

Satisfaction guarantee and retake option

9.45

Students rated our trainers 9.45 out of 10 based on 5017 reviews

Class was very informative. Knowlegable instructor.

Gayle Nybo, Midwest Assistance Program
New Prague MN

By far the best Web-based education system out there - fairly priced, easy to use and comes with an array of course selections.

Laura Oppenheimer, Torus
Jersey City NJ

The class actually exceeded my expectations - I thought it was going to be boring at points, but it was hands-on the whole time, and I was actively engaged in the class the whole time.

Angie Wallace, Riverlake Partners
Portland OR

I have enjoyed both courses I have taken and hope to do more.

Rachel Chudoba, JUMP Technology Services
OKLAHOMA CITY OK

Contact Us or call 1-877-932-8228